I would like to have some idea of voltages for my 2.6c.. What is the stock voltage, what is an acceptable voltage to raise too for overclocking purposes. I am running a P4C800E asus board, the temps for the core are flucuating in cpu id...??? I am running at 3.2 with core voltage set to 1.6, and i am getting a reading of 1.536 to 1.552 under load, normal idle i am running at 1.632 to 1.648. at 1.648, that is more than i specified in the bios setting on my asus board. Why am i flucating so much, and furthermore why are the voltages much higher than what i set too in the bios? Thanks, John
 
I'm not an Intel d00d, so I don't know what stock voltage is (1.65v?), but I can answer one of your questions.

As your computer chugs along, the voltage regulator on the mainboard adjusts the voltage to the CPU depending on the load on it. That doesn't mean it can increase your voltage to make you stable at a higher clock. Under load, your voltage can drop or increase as you are stressing your system. When you idle, it's not so stressful, so the voltage might increase or drop, depending on many complicated things.

Some boards, like mine, tend to overvolt or undervolt the CPU compared to the setting you specify in the BIOS. Another explination could be that the program reading your voltage isn't accurate, as the method for detecting the voltage is to mesure the draw, and then run math on that to get the voltage.

I wouldn't worry about fluctuations too much, although it could be a sign that your powersupply is being stressed or is about to kick the bucket. Use MBM to monitor your 12v, 5v, and 3.3v rails. That will give you an indication about how the magic smoke in your PSU is doing, and if it's about to escape (lots of up and down == BAD, within +- 5% is good if you're on stock settings, within +- 10% for overclocked settings is good).
